VMware12安装Kali Linux教程

vmware12装kali

时间:2025-03-18 22:43


VMware 12 上高效安装与配置 Kali Linux:深度指南 在当今的信息安全领域,Kali Linux 作为一款专为渗透测试和网络安全专家设计的发行版,其强大的功能和丰富的工具集使其成为不可或缺的操作系统

    对于许多安全研究人员和爱好者来说,在虚拟机中运行 Kali Linux 是一种理想的选择,既能保护主机系统不受潜在风险影响,又能方便地测试各种安全工具和技巧

    VMware Workstation 12 作为一款强大的虚拟化软件,提供了完美的平台来安装和配置 Kali Linux

    本文将详细介绍如何在 VMware Workstation 12 上高效安装与配置 Kali Linux,确保每一步都清晰明了,帮助读者轻松上手

     一、准备工作 在开始安装之前,确保你已经完成了以下几项准备工作: 1.下载 VMware Workstation 12: 确保你已经从 VMware 官方网站下载并安装了 VMware Workstation 12

    如果尚未安装,请访问 VMware 官网下载最新版本的软件并按照提示完成安装

     2.下载 Kali Linux ISO 镜像: 前往 Kali Linux 官方网站下载最新的 ISO 镜像文件

    根据你的需求选择适合的版本(如 Live、Installer 或 Minimal)

    推荐使用 Installer 版本,因为它提供了完整的安装选项

     3.创建虚拟机: 打开 VMware Workstation 12,点击“创建新的虚拟机”,选择“典型(推荐)”或“自定义(高级)”安装类型

    对于大多数用户来说,“典型”安装足以满足需求

     二、配置虚拟机设置 1.选择安装介质: 在创建虚拟机向导中,选择“稍后安装操作系统”,因为我们稍后将手动指定 ISO 镜像文件

     2.选择操作系统和版本: 在操作系统选择页面,选择“Linux”,然后在版本下拉菜单中选择“Debian 9.x 64-bit”(尽管 Kali Linux 基于 Debian,但选择最接近的版本通常不会影响安装过程)

     3.命名虚拟机: 为你的虚拟机命名,并选择一个合适的存储位置

     4.配置磁盘大小: 设置磁盘大小,建议至少分配 20GB 的磁盘空间,以确保有足够的空间安装应用程序和存储数据

    选择“将虚拟磁盘存储为单个文件”可以简化管理

     5.自定义硬件设置: 在虚拟机创建完成后,点击“编辑虚拟机设置”进行进一步的配置

    重点调整以下设置: -内存:分配给虚拟机至少 2GB 的内存,以确保系统流畅运行

     -处理器:根据你的 CPU 核心数分配适量的处理器核心,通常 2 个核心足够

     -CD/DVD 驱动器:选择“使用 ISO 镜像文件”,并浏览到你下载的 Kali Linux ISO 镜像文件

     三、安装 Kali Linux 1.启动虚拟机: 完成上述配置后,点击“开启此虚拟机”开始安装过程

     2.启动菜单选项: 虚拟机启动后,你将看到 Kali Linux 的启动菜单

    选择“Install”开始安装过程

     3.选择安装语言: 在安装向导中,选择你的首选语言,然后点击“继续”

     4.配置键盘布局: 选择适合你的键盘布局,通常默认设置即可

     5.设置网络连接: 在网络配置页面,你可以选择是否使用网络镜像

    对于大多数用户来说,保持默认设置(即通过网络获取更新和软件包)是合适的

     6.设置时区: 选择你的地理位置和时区,确保系统时间准确无误

     7.创建磁盘分区: 这是安装过程中最关键的一步之一

    你可以选择“手动”分区或使用“Guided - use entire disk”选项

    对于初学者,推荐使用“Guided - use entire disk”并选择你刚刚创建的虚拟机磁盘

    按照向导提示完成分区设置

     8.设置 root 密码和创建用户: 在配置 root 密码页面,设置一个强密码以确保系统安全

    接下来,创建一个新用户并为其设置密码

    建议日常使用非 root 用户进行操作,以减少安全风险

     9.安装 GRUB 引导加载器: 在 GRUB 安装页面,保持默认设置,将 GRUB 安装到虚拟机的主磁盘上

     10. 完成安装: 安装完成后,系统会提示你移除安装介质并重启虚拟机

    此时,你可以关闭虚拟机设置窗口中的 ISO 镜像挂载,然后重启虚拟机

     四、首次启动与配置 1.首次启动: 重启虚拟机后,Kali Linux 将首次启动

    在 GRUB 菜单中选择默认的启动选项进入系统

     2.完成初始化设置: 首次登录时,系统可能会提示你完成一些初始化设置,如更新软件包列表、配置软件源等

    建议更新所有软件包以确保系统安全

     3.安装常用工具: 根据你的需求,安装一些常用的安全工具

    例如,可以使用 `apt-get install` 命令安装 Metasploit Framework、Nmap、Wireshark 等

     4.配置网络: 确保虚拟机能够访问外部网络

    你可以通过 VMware 的网络适配器设置选择 NAT 或桥接模式

    NAT 模式允许虚拟机通过主机访问互联网,而桥接模式则让虚拟机在网络中表现得像一台独立的计算机

     5.增强功能安装: 安装 VMware Tools 可以增强虚拟机与宿主机之间的交互,如共享文件夹、拖放功能、全屏模式等

    在 Kali Linux 中,你可以通过以下命令安装 open-vm-tools: ```bash sudo apt-get update sudo apt-get install open-vm-tools open-vm-tools-desktopfuse ``` 五、优化与定制 1.更新系统: 定期更新系统是保持安全的重要步骤

    使用 `apt-get update` 和`apt-getupgrade` 命令来更新软件包

     2.配置防火墙: 根据你的需求配置防火墙规则

    Kali Linux 默认使用 `ufw`(Uncomplicated Firewall)

    你可以通过以下命令启用并配置防火墙: ```bash sudo ufw enable sudo ufw allow ``` 3.定制桌面环境: Kali Linux 默认使用 GNOME 桌面环境

    你可以根据个人喜好调整桌面设置、安装主题和图标包等

     4.备份与恢复: 定期备份重要数据和配置文件

    你可以使用`rsync`、`tar` 等工具创建备份,或者考虑使用虚拟机快照功能来快速恢复到某个特定状态

     六、总结 通过 VMware Workstation 12 安装和配置 Kali Linux 是一个既高效又安全的过程

    本文详细介绍了从准备工作到安装、配置及优化的每一步骤,旨在帮助读者轻松上手

    无论是安全研究人员、渗透测试工程师还是网络安全爱好者,都能在虚拟机中充分利用 Kali Linux 的强大功能,进行各种安全测试和实验

    记住,保持系统更新、合理配置防火墙和定期备份是确保安全的关键步骤

    现在,你已经准备好在 VMware Workstation 12 上运行 Kali Linux,开始你的信息安全之旅吧!